    So i'm having some major issues with my truck. I think they are all electrical. Some background first. My truck got broken into 2 or 3 weeks ago and they tried taking the stereo, but instead mangled the dash. I had to replace the whole dash. I got an aftermarket alarm installed by a local company as hope to prevent and future problems.

    Today I'm driving around during lunch. Get out and turn off my truck for all of 10 seconds and I get back in and it won't start. The dash lights aren't coming on when I turn the key. I eventually get it push started and it seems to be running fine, but my radio starts going off whenever I hit the breaks. So I got home and disconnect the stereo (including power cable connected to battery for my amps) and it still wouldn't start. I again push started it and I went to Autozone and had them test the battery and it was fine. I was able to start the truck up with no issues this time. I have no radio and the amps are disconnected.

    My buddy who helped me work on the truck (replace the dash) says he thinks it might be from the alarm that was installed. I think it might be the amps having issues draining the battery, but I feel like it should recharge while the car was running.

    Anyone have any idea what the problem could be or any suggestions on what to do problem shoot my problem? :confused:
